.dropdown__container,.mega-menu__container{background-color:#fff;color:#000}details[is=details-mega] .mega-menu__wrapper{flex-wrap:nowrap;align-items:flex-start;gap:2rem;max-width:150rem;margin-inline:auto;padding-inline:clamp(6rem,10vw,16rem)}details[is=details-mega] .mega-menu__list{display:flex!important;flex-direction:row!important;align-items:flex-start!important;gap:6rem!important;flex:1 1 auto;min-width:0}details[is=details-mega] .mega-menu__col{flex:1 1 0!important;min-width:0!important;display:flex!important;flex-direction:column!important;align-items:flex-start!important;gap:0!important}details[is=details-mega] .mega-menu__item{width:100%;margin-bottom:2.5rem!important}details[is=details-mega] .mega-menu__item-wrapper{padding-inline-start:0;border-inline-start:0}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__wrapper{display:block}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card{border-radius:1.8rem;overflow:hidden;background-color:#f2f2f2}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__image-wrapper{width:100%;border-radius:0}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__image{--aspect-ratio: 1 !important}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__info{padding:1.4rem 1.6rem 1.8rem!important;gap:.5rem}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__title{margin:0;line-height:1.25}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card .f-price{margin:.2rem 0 0}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__vendor,details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__type{display:none}details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__quickview,details[is=details-mega] .mega-menu__promotions .promotion-item--product .product-card__main-actions{display:none!important}.dropdown__container a,.mega-menu__container a{color:#000}.menu-drawer .menu-drawer__nested-caret{display:inline-flex;transition:transform .25s ease}.menu-drawer .menu-drawer__nested-dropdown[open]>summary .menu-drawer__nested-caret{transform:rotate(90deg)}.menu-drawer .menu-drawer__nested-links{margin:.8rem 0 .2rem 1.2rem;padding:.2rem 0 .2rem 1.2rem;border-inline-start:1px solid rgb(var(--color-border))}.menu-drawer .menu-drawer__item--nested{padding-block:.45rem}.menu-drawer .menu-drawer__item--nested .menu-drawer__item-link{font-size:var(--font-body-size);font-family:var(--font-body-family);font-weight:var(--font-body-weight);font-style:var(--font-body-style);text-transform:none}.mega-menu__promotions-grid{grid-template-columns:repeat(var(--promotion-columns, 3),1fr)!important}
/*# sourceMappingURL=/cdn/shop/t/9/assets/custom-menu-overrides.css.map */
